Introduction to PPA-CF (Polyphthalamide Carbon Fiber Composite)

PPA-CF (Polyphthalamide with Carbon Fiber Reinforcement) is a high-performance engineering thermoplastic composite that combines the excellent high-temperature resistance and chemical stability of Polyphthalamide (PPA) with the high strength and low weight properties of carbon fiber. This material exhibits outstanding mechanical properties, thermal stability, and wear resistance, making it ideal for use in industries that require high strength, high temperature tolerance, chemical resistance, and abrasion resistance.

Key Features of PPA-CF:

Exceptional High-Temperature Performance

PPA-CF offers outstanding thermal stability, maintaining its mechanical properties even in high temperature environments. It can perform at temperatures up to 200°C, making it particularly suitable for automotive engine compartments, electronic devices, and other high heat environments.

Excellent Mechanical Properties

Carbon fiber reinforcement significantly enhances the tensile strength, compressive strength, and impact resistance of PPA CF. This makes it particularly valuable in applications that require resistance to dynamic loads and impacts. Its high strength and rigidity enable it to perform reliably under harsh working conditions.

Superior Wear Resistance

The addition of carbon fiber greatly improves the wear resistance of PPA CF, allowing it to excel in high friction environments. Whether used in mechanical parts, sports equipment, or automotive components, PPA CF’s wear resistance helps extend the service life of these parts, reducing wear and increasing reliability.

Good Chemical Stability

PPA CF exhibits strong chemical resistance, making it highly resistant to oils, fuels, solvents, and acidic or alkaline substances. This property makes it an ideal choice for automotive, industrial, and electronic applications, especially in environments where the material is exposed to harsh chemicals, ensuring long term stability and reliability.

Lightweight with High Strength

Despite the addition of carbon fiber, PPA CF remains relatively lightweight while offering high strength, making it particularly suitable for applications in industries such as aerospace and automotive, where reducing weight is crucial. This lightweight characteristic helps lower structural weight, improve energy efficiency, and enhance ease of use.

Applications of PPA-CF:

Automotive Industry

PPA CF is widely used in automotive components such as engine parts, transmission system components, fuel systems, and seals. These parts are typically exposed to high temperatures, pressures, and chemical environments. PPA-CF’s high temperature resistance, chemical stability, and wear resistance make it ideal for ensuring long term performance in these demanding conditions.

Electronics Industry

In the electronics sector, PPA CF is used to manufacture high strength components like housings, connectors, plugs, and sockets. Its heat resistance and impact resistance make it an ideal material to protect internal components in high-temperature, vibration-prone environments, ensuring the safety and reliability of electronic devices.

Industrial Equipment

PPA CF is used in various industrial applications, particularly where high wear resistance, high temperature stability, and chemical resistance are required. For instance, it is employed in the production of gears, bearings, pump housings, and seals, improving durability while reducing maintenance costs and extending the service life of industrial equipment.

Aerospace Industry

Due to its high strength to weight ratio, PPA CF is widely used in the aerospace industry, especially for manufacturing structural components, engine parts, and other aerospace components that require high material performance. PPA CF helps reduce the weight of aircraft, improving energy efficiency while ensuring safety and reliability in critical applications.

Sports Equipment

PPA CF is also used in high performance sports equipment, such as bicycle frames, sports shoes, and skis. These products require excellent strength, durability, and shock absorption, and PPA CF provides an ideal solution for these demanding applications.
